Clara earned her Bachelor’s degree in Music Education with a minor in Psychology from San José State University. She began studying music at age six and later won multiple awards at the Hong Kong Schools Music Festival in piano, voice, and flute. As an experienced accompanist, she has supported ensembles in rehearsals, performances, and competitions locally and internationally. During her time with SJSU’s top chamber singers, Clara performed at Carnegie Hall in New York, Benaroya Hall in Seattle, and toured in Spain and Portugal.
In 2025, Clara completed Level 1 training in elementary music pedagogy through the American Orff Schulwerk Association and became certified by the Royal Conservatory of Music to teach elementary piano. These qualifications help her teach with a structured curriculum that keeps lessons engaging and fun. Clara also serves as a choir director for local elementary schools and churches. With more than five years of private teaching experience, she believes every student can discover their own voice through music. Her lessons are personalized to each student, building confidence through recitals and success in ABRSM and RCM exams. Clara is fluent in Mandarin, Cantonese, and English.
